BODY {
margin: 0px 0px 0px 0px;
}


P, TD, OL,  DIV, H1, H2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#333333;
}


A:link{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	font-weight: bold;
	color:#2D3514;
	text-decoration: none;
	padding: 3px;

}
A: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	font-weight: bold;
	color:#2D3514;
	text-decoration: none;
	padding: 3px;

}
A:hover{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	font-weight: bold;
	color:#2D3514;
    background-color: #e4ff02;
    border-bottom: 1px solid #777777;
    border-top: 1px solid #777777;

	text-decoration: none;
	padding: 3px;

}
A:active{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-style: normal;
	text-decoration: none;
    font-weight:bold;
    color:#465418;
    padding: 3px;


}

.headertable{
border-left: 1px solid #ffffff;
border-right: 1px solid #ffffff;
width: 700px;
background-color: #e4ff02;
background-image: url(headerwriting.jpg);
background-position: 0% 100%;
background-repeat: repeat-x;

}

.headerrighttable{
width: 300px;

}

.headerlefttable A:link{
background-color: none;
}



.headerlogo{
width: 150px;
}

.headernav{
width: 600px;
}

.contenttable{
border-left: medium solid #ffffff;
border-right: medium solid #ffffff;
width: 700px;
padding: 0px;
background-color: #CCCCCC;
}

.centercontenttable{
border-left: 1px dotted #CCCCCC;
border-right: 1px dotted #CCCCCC;
border-top: 1px dotted #CCCCCC;
border-bottom: 1px dotted #CCCCCC;
padding: 10px;
background-color:  white;
}

.rightcontenttable{
border-left: 1px dotted #CCCCCC;
border-right: 1px dotted #CCCCCC;
border-top: 1px dotted #CCCCCC;
border-bottom: 1px dotted #CCCCCC;
width: 280px;
align: right;
padding: 10px;
background-color: #CCCCCC;
line-height: 100%;
color:764D4E;
}




.leftcontenttable{
border-left: 1px dotted #CCCCCC;
border-right: 1px dotted #CCCCCC;
border-top: 1px dotted #CCCCCC;
border-bottom: 1px dotted #CCCCCC;
width: 144px;
padding: 3px;
background-color: #CCCCCC
}


.contentstyle{
border-left: 1px dotted #F8FBF1;
padding: 15; 
}


.mainTbl{
border: 1px solid #C67D0B;
}



.spaceTop{
font-size: 16px;
letter-spacing: 30px;
font-family: Georgia, Geneva,  Trebuchet MS,  serif;
font-style: normal;
	font-weight: bold;
	font-variant: normal;
}



.title{
font-size: 26px;
letter-spacing: 10px;
font-family: Georgia, Geneva,  Trebuchet MS,  serif;
font-style: normal;
font-variant: normal;
}


